## Authentication

Querybench regressed after the Falkner planner update; support must pull raw plan traces directly. Trace access bypasses the dashboard and hits the internal planner service. All requests require a service key in the request header. Do not share it outside the support rotation. Use the key below when fetching traces.

service key, kaduf-bawig: kto15_Ze79S0dligTw0yO

## Step 3: Point Pagemute at the new dedup cluster

OK, almost done. Once the old Pagemute dedup nodes are drained, switch your support tooling to the new cluster. Alerts will briefly double-fire during cutover — that's expected, just don't ack them twice. Before flipping the switch, double-check your settings match what's below.

service settings:
[ulair]
team = praath
access_code = ac_06d704
owner = wenix.ulair
host = ulair.qirvancorp.corp
port = 9200
peer = sorys.nelvronet.internal
salt = 2668132c
pin = 9140

## Build provenance: thumbnail generation queue

The Pixelbarrow thumbnail queue workers are built from the monorepo's media/ tree and stamped at package time. Reviewers should confirm that the worker image matches the manifest checked into the release branch — mismatches have caused stale resize logic to ship twice. Provenance records live in the Ironvale artifact store for one year. The token identifying the current worker build is shown below.

session token of yajof-bagef = htk4_937d

Subject: Quickstore 4.2 — bloom filter now fronts the KV layer

Plugin authors: starting with this release, Quickstore places a bloom filter ahead of the key-value store. Negative lookups return faster; false positives fall through safely. No API changes are required on your side. Verify your plugin against the staging build referenced below.

session token of fahif-tadup = htk3_9c7